diff options
author | Joe Marcus Clarke <marcus@FreeBSD.org> | 2004-04-05 02:52:41 +0000 |
---|---|---|
committer | Joe Marcus Clarke <marcus@FreeBSD.org> | 2004-04-05 02:52:41 +0000 |
commit | ccc106f76aee3ac6576ae0a1663354524211ae37 (patch) | |
tree | f5cec31b09b9f41a5fef70866df98e8ed37333c7 /Mk | |
parent | o Fix recursive definition of PKGNAMESUFFIX. (diff) |
Update to GNOME 2.6, and add all the new shared library versions. No other
functionality has been added or removed.
Notes
Notes:
svn path=/head/; revision=106169
Diffstat (limited to 'Mk')
-rw-r--r-- | Mk/bsd.gnome.mk | 41 |
1 files changed, 20 insertions, 21 deletions
diff --git a/Mk/bsd.gnome.mk b/Mk/bsd.gnome.mk index 0230d9ba4a30..9378b85b085a 100644 --- a/Mk/bsd.gnome.mk +++ b/Mk/bsd.gnome.mk @@ -27,7 +27,7 @@ Gnome_Pre_Include= bsd.gnome.mk # non-version specific components _USE_GNOME_ALL= gnomehack lthack gnomeprefix gnomehier esound gnomemimedata \ - gnometarget pkgconfig intltool intlhack + gnometarget pkgconfig intltool intlhack # GNOME 1 components _USE_GNOME_ALL+=libghttp glib12 gtk12 libxml gdkpixbuf imlib orbit \ @@ -62,7 +62,7 @@ gnomehack_PRE_PATCH= ${FIND} ${WRKSRC} -name "Makefile.in*" | ${XARGS} ${REINPLA s|DATADIRNAME=lib|DATADIRNAME=share|g' lthack_PRE_PATCH= ${FIND} ${WRKSRC} -name "configure" | ${XARGS} ${REINPLACE_CMD} -e \ - '/^LIBTOOL_DEPS="$$ac_aux_dir\/ltmain.sh"$$/s|$$|; $$ac_aux_dir/ltconfig $$LIBTOOL_DEPS;|' + '/^LIBTOOL_DEPS="$$ac_aux_dir\/ltmain.sh"$$/s|$$|; $$ac_aux_dir/ltconfig $$LIBTOOL_DEPS;|' gnomehier_DETECT= ${X11BASE}/share/gnome/.keep_me gnomehier_RUN_DEPENDS= ${gnomehier_DETECT}:${PORTSDIR}/misc/gnomehier @@ -221,19 +221,19 @@ pygnome_BUILD_DEPENDS= ${pygnome_DETECT}:${PORTSDIR}/x11-toolkits/py-gnome pygnome_RUN_DEPENDS= ${pygnome_DETECT}:${PORTSDIR}/x11-toolkits/py-gnome pygnome_USE_GNOME_IMPL= gtkhtml pygtk -glib20_LIB_DEPENDS= glib-2.0.200:${PORTSDIR}/devel/glib20 +glib20_LIB_DEPENDS= glib-2.0.400:${PORTSDIR}/devel/glib20 glib20_DETECT= ${LOCALBASE}/libdata/pkgconfig/glib-2.0.pc glib20_USE_GNOME_IMPL=gnometarget pkgconfig -atk_LIB_DEPENDS= atk-1.0.400:${PORTSDIR}/accessibility/atk +atk_LIB_DEPENDS= atk-1.0.600:${PORTSDIR}/accessibility/atk atk_DETECT= ${LOCALBASE}/libdata/pkgconfig/atk.pc atk_USE_GNOME_IMPL= glib20 -pango_LIB_DEPENDS= pango-1.0.200:${PORTSDIR}/x11-toolkits/pango +pango_LIB_DEPENDS= pango-1.0.399:${PORTSDIR}/x11-toolkits/pango pango_DETECT= ${X11BASE}/libdata/pkgconfig/pango.pc pango_USE_GNOME_IMPL= glib20 -gtk20_LIB_DEPENDS= gtk-x11-2.0.200:${PORTSDIR}/x11-toolkits/gtk20 +gtk20_LIB_DEPENDS= gtk-x11-2.0.400:${PORTSDIR}/x11-toolkits/gtk20 gtk20_DETECT= ${X11BASE}/libdata/pkgconfig/gtk+-x11-2.0.pc gtk20_USE_GNOME_IMPL= intltool atk pango @@ -269,7 +269,7 @@ gconf2_LIB_DEPENDS= gconf-2.5:${PORTSDIR}/devel/gconf2 gconf2_DETECT= ${X11BASE}/libdata/pkgconfig/gconf-2.0.pc gconf2_USE_GNOME_IMPL= orbit2 libxml2 gtk20 linc -gnomevfs2_LIB_DEPENDS= gnomevfs-2.400:${PORTSDIR}/devel/gnomevfs2 +gnomevfs2_LIB_DEPENDS= gnomevfs-2.600:${PORTSDIR}/devel/gnomevfs2 gnomevfs2_DETECT= ${X11BASE}/libdata/pkgconfig/gnome-vfs-2.0.pc gnomevfs2_USE_GNOME_IMPL=gconf2 libbonobo gnomemimedata @@ -277,7 +277,7 @@ gail_LIB_DEPENDS= gailutil.17:${PORTSDIR}/accessibility/gail gail_DETECT= ${X11BASE}/libdata/pkgconfig/gail.pc gail_USE_GNOME_IMPL= libgnomecanvas -libgnomecanvas_LIB_DEPENDS= gnomecanvas-2.400:${PORTSDIR}/graphics/libgnomecanvas +libgnomecanvas_LIB_DEPENDS= gnomecanvas-2.600:${PORTSDIR}/graphics/libgnomecanvas libgnomecanvas_DETECT= ${X11BASE}/libdata/pkgconfig/libgnomecanvas-2.0.pc libgnomecanvas_USE_GNOME_IMPL= libglade2 libartlgpl2 @@ -293,7 +293,7 @@ libgnomeprintui_LIB_DEPENDS= gnomeprintui-2-2.1:${PORTSDIR}/x11-toolkits/libgnom libgnomeprintui_DETECT= ${X11BASE}/libdata/pkgconfig/libgnomeprintui-2.2.pc libgnomeprintui_USE_GNOME_IMPL= libgnomeprint libgnomecanvas -libgnome_LIB_DEPENDS= gnome-2.400:${PORTSDIR}/x11/libgnome +libgnome_LIB_DEPENDS= gnome-2.600:${PORTSDIR}/x11/libgnome libgnome_DETECT= ${X11BASE}/libdata/pkgconfig/libgnome-2.0.pc libgnome_USE_GNOME_IMPL=libxslt gnomevfs2 esound @@ -301,7 +301,7 @@ libbonoboui_LIB_DEPENDS= bonoboui-2.0:${PORTSDIR}/x11-toolkits/libbonoboui libbonoboui_DETECT= ${X11BASE}/libdata/pkgconfig/libbonoboui-2.0.pc libbonoboui_USE_GNOME_IMPL= libgnomecanvas libgnome -libgnomeui_LIB_DEPENDS= gnomeui-2.400:${PORTSDIR}/x11-toolkits/libgnomeui +libgnomeui_LIB_DEPENDS= gnomeui-2.600:${PORTSDIR}/x11-toolkits/libgnomeui libgnomeui_DETECT= ${X11BASE}/libdata/pkgconfig/libgnomeui-2.0.pc libgnomeui_USE_GNOME_IMPL= libbonoboui @@ -322,7 +322,7 @@ gnomedesktop_DETECT= ${X11BASE}/libdata/pkgconfig/gnome-desktop-2.0.pc gnomedesktop_USE_GNOME_IMPL= libgnomeui gnomedesktop_GNOME_DESKTOP_VERSION=2 -libwnck_LIB_DEPENDS= wnck-1.11:${PORTSDIR}/x11-toolkits/libwnck +libwnck_LIB_DEPENDS= wnck-1.13:${PORTSDIR}/x11-toolkits/libwnck libwnck_DETECT= ${X11BASE}/libdata/pkgconfig/libwnck-1.0.pc libwnck_USE_GNOME_IMPL= gtk20 @@ -334,11 +334,11 @@ libzvt_LIB_DEPENDS= zvt-2.0.0:${PORTSDIR}/x11-toolkits/libzvt libzvt_DETECT= ${X11BASE}/libdata/pkgconfig/libzvt-2.0.pc libzvt_USE_GNOME_IMPL= gtk20 -librsvg2_LIB_DEPENDS= rsvg-2.6:${PORTSDIR}/graphics/librsvg2 +librsvg2_LIB_DEPENDS= rsvg-2.8:${PORTSDIR}/graphics/librsvg2 librsvg2_DETECT= ${X11BASE}/libdata/pkgconfig/librsvg-2.0.pc librsvg2_USE_GNOME_IMPL=libartlgpl2 libxml2 gtk20 libgsf -eel2_LIB_DEPENDS= eel-2.6:${PORTSDIR}/x11-toolkits/eel2 +eel2_LIB_DEPENDS= eel-2.8:${PORTSDIR}/x11-toolkits/eel2 eel2_DETECT= ${X11BASE}/libdata/pkgconfig/eel-2.0.pc eel2_USE_GNOME_IMPL= gnomevfs2 libgnomeui gail @@ -376,8 +376,8 @@ gtksourceview_LIB_DEPENDS= gtksourceview-1.0.0:${PORTSDIR}/x11-toolkits/gtksourc gtksourceview_DETECT= ${X11BASE}/libdata/pkgconfig/gtksourceview-1.0.pc gtksourceview_USE_GNOME_IMPL=libgnome libgnomeprintui -pkgconfig_BUILD_DEPENDS= pkg-config:${PORTSDIR}/devel/pkgconfig pkgconfig_DETECT= ${LOCALBASE}/bin/pkg-config +pkgconfig_BUILD_DEPENDS= pkg-config:${PORTSDIR}/devel/pkgconfig pkgconfig_RUN_DEPENDS= pkg-config:${PORTSDIR}/devel/pkgconfig libgsf_LIB_DEPENDS= gsf-1.9:${PORTSDIR}/devel/libgsf @@ -394,17 +394,17 @@ pygnome2_BUILD_DEPENDS= ${pygnome2_DETECT}:${PORTSDIR}/x11-toolkits/py-gnome2 pygnome2_RUN_DEPENDS= ${pygnome2_DETECT}:${PORTSDIR}/x11-toolkits/py-gnome2 pygnome2_USE_GNOME_IMPL=libgnomeprintui libgtkhtml gnomepanel libzvt nautilus2 pygtk2 -gstreamerplugins_LIB_DEPENDS= gstplay-0.6.1:${PORTSDIR}/multimedia/gstreamer-plugins \ - gstreamer-0.6:${PORTSDIR}/multimedia/gstreamer -gstreamerplugins_DETECT= ${X11BASE}/libdata/pkgconfig/gstreamer-play-0.6.pc -gstreamerplugins_USE_GNOME_IMPL= gconf2 +gstreamerplugins_LIB_DEPENDS= gstplay-0.8.1:${PORTSDIR}/multimedia/gstreamer-plugins \ + gstreamer-0.8:${PORTSDIR}/multimedia/gstreamer +gstreamerplugins_DETECT= ${X11BASE}/libdata/pkgconfig/gstreamer-play-0.7.pc +gstreamerplugins_USE_GNOME_IMPL= gconf2 intltool_DETECT= ${LOCALBASE}/bin/intltool-extract intltool_BUILD_DEPENDS= ${intltool_DETECT}:${PORTSDIR}/textproc/intltool intlhack_PRE_PATCH= ${FIND} ${WRKSRC} -name "intltool-merge.in" | ${XARGS} ${REINPLACE_CMD} -e \ - 's|mkdir $$lang or|mkdir $$lang, 0777 or| ; \ - s|^push @INC, "/.*|push @INC, "${LOCALBASE}/share/intltool";|' + 's|mkdir $$lang or|mkdir $$lang, 0777 or| ; \ + s|^push @INC, "/.*|push @INC, "${LOCALBASE}/share/intltool";|' intlhack_USE_GNOME_IMPL=intltool gtkhtml3_LIB_DEPENDS= gtkhtml-3.0.4:${PORTSDIR}/www/gtkhtml3 @@ -461,7 +461,6 @@ GNOME_DESKTOP_VERSION?= 2 # it does, and its requirement disagrees with the user's chosen desktop, # do not add the component to the HAVE_GNOME list. -USE_GNOME?= _USE_GNOME_SAVED:=${USE_GNOME} _USE_GNOME_DESKTOP=yes HAVE_GNOME?= |